Ahead of its March 5, 2026 Nintendo Switch 2 launch, Pokémon Pokopia has already made history — critics have awarded it an 89 out of 100 on Metacritic based on around 50 reviews, making it the highest-rated entry in the franchise’s 30-year history. The game also holds a 93% Critics Recommend score on OpenCritic, far ahead of Pokémon X and Y’s combined 84% on the same platform.kotaku+1
The game is a life-simulation spin-off co-developed by Koei Tecmo’s Omega Force and Game Freak, drawing immediate comparisons to Animal Crossing, Dragon Quest Builders, and Viva Piñata. GamesRadar‘s Sam Loveridge called it “a brilliantly bizarre blend of Pokémon, Animal Crossing, Dragon Quest Builders, and Viva Piñata” that still “manages to be a unique spin-off”.

What Pokopia Actually Is
In Pokopia, you play as Ditto transformed into human form, which is central to the gameplay — your character can learn and use moves from other Pokémon to reshape environments, solve puzzles, and build habitats. The game supports up to four-player co-op for collaborative world-building. The world also features a real-time day/night cycle, dynamic weather, and seasonal changes that affect Pokémon spawning and behavior.
The game features a Pokédex with at least 300 Pokémon — confirmed to be larger than 2025’s Legends: Z-A. IGN awarded it a 9/10, praising it as “a real treat: an enjoyable building and town simulator that capitalizes on the charming personalities of its monsters” and noting it “strikes a healthy balance between freedom and suggestion in its building mechanics”. GAMINGbible and TechRadar Gaming both gave it perfect scores, while only two outlets rated it “Mixed”.
Historic Achievement for a Spin-Off
What makes Pokopia’s score especially remarkable is the context: every other title in the franchise’s Metacritic top 10 is either a mainline game or a direct remake. Pokopia is not only the first spin-off to reach this ranking — it’s also the first Pokémon title of the 2020s to break into the top 10, after a string of games that divided the fanbase. Nintendo Life awarded it 8/10 and called it “the freshest Pokémon experience in a long time”.gamesradar+1
It’s also currently the best-reviewed game of 2026 overall, edging out Resident Evil Requiem (88) and Mewgenics for the top spot. However, scores remain subject to change as more reviews are published in the days around launch.
